  • 3.00 Credits

    Prerequisite: MUSC 122 and MUSC 112. Corequisite: MUSC 113. A study of chord structure and chord progression from the period of common harmonic practice. Proper voice leading, three or four-part writing is emphasized, along with analysis and composition studies in major and minor keys. Includes non-chord tones, diatonic sevenths, and dominant sevenths. Students must earn a "C" or better in both MUSC 113 and MUSC 123 to progress to MUSC 222 (Music Theory III) and MUSC 212 (Ear Training/Sightsinging III).
  • 1.00 Credits

    A diverse variety of band repertoire will be rehearsed and performed each term. Works to be studied will include, but not be limited to, orchestral transcriptions, original band and wind ensemble works, solos with band accompaniment, and section features. Instruction will also include coaching toward proper ensemble/individual performance techniques, sight reading, and rhythmic reading skills. Open to all students who have high school experience playing a traditional band instrument.

  • 1.00 Credits

    A diverse variety of jazz-related repertoire will be rehearsed and performed each term. Works to be studied will include, but not limited to, transcriptions, original jazz and big band ensemble works, solos with band accompaniment, and section features. Instruction will also include coaching toward proper ensemble/individual performance techniques, sight reading, and rhythmic reading skills. Open to all students who have high school experience playing a traditional jazz ensemble instrument.
